Course Content

• **Nonprofit Risk Identification & Assessment Fundamentals:** This foundational unit covers the essential concepts of risk management tailored to the nonprofit sector, including risk appetite, risk tolerance, and the risk assessment process.
• **Legal & Regulatory Compliance in Nonprofits:** This module focuses on relevant laws, regulations, and standards impacting nonprofits, including charity law, tax regulations, and data protection.
• **Financial Risk Management for Nonprofits:** This unit delves into financial risks specific to nonprofits, covering topics like budgeting, fundraising, grant management, and financial fraud prevention.
• **Operational Risk Management in Nonprofit Organizations:** This module examines operational risks, including program delivery, volunteer management, technology, and cybersecurity risks within nonprofit settings.
• **Strategic Risk Management & Scenario Planning for Nonprofits:** This unit explores strategic risks, such as reputational damage, mission drift, and sustainability challenges, and teaches techniques for scenario planning.
• **Risk Mitigation & Response Strategies:** This unit will cover developing and implementing effective risk mitigation and response plans, including crisis management and business continuity planning.
• **Board Governance & Risk Oversight:** This module focuses on the role of the board of directors in overseeing risk management within a nonprofit organization.
• **Communication & Stakeholder Engagement in Risk Management:** This unit covers effective communication strategies for reporting risk and engaging stakeholders in the risk management process.
• **Insurance & Risk Transfer for Nonprofits:** This unit explores various insurance options available to nonprofits and how to effectively transfer and manage risk.

Career path

Career Role (Nonprofit Risk Management) Description
Risk Manager (Charity Sector) Develops and implements risk mitigation strategies for UK charities, ensuring compliance and financial stability. High demand for strong analytical and communication skills.
Compliance Officer (Nonprofit) Oversees regulatory adherence within UK nonprofits, identifying and addressing potential legal and ethical risks. Requires keen attention to detail and knowledge of relevant legislation.
Internal Auditor (NGO) Conducts internal audits to assess risk exposure and the effectiveness of controls within UK-based NGOs. Expertise in auditing standards and risk assessment is essential.
Fraud Prevention Specialist (Voluntary Sector) Develops and implements strategies to prevent and detect fraud within the UK's voluntary sector, contributing to the financial integrity of nonprofits. Strong investigative skills are crucial.
